Item Description
2" real photo, without dot screen, color tinted pocket mirror without text but given the hair color on this gorgeous photo portrait of Harlow this is c. the 1931 release of the comedy drama "Platinum Blonde" directed by Frank Capra. No maker's name. Silvering is 100% intact. Cello has quite a few diagonal surface scratches from .25" up to 1" but these are extremely light with barely any depth into the celluloid so while they catch reflected light with normal viewing straight on none are visible. There is a tiny dot on her right cheek that shows but this is under the cello as made. Overall, glossy and VF but displaying NM. The only vintage Harlow mirror known to us. Rare.
